  1. These checks are specified in the testing charts. Output State Test is used to diagnose each actuator. Test is performed in the Key On-Engine Off Self-Test mode after service codes have been sent. DO NOT  disable self-test, but momentarily depress throttle and release. All auxiliary EEC outputs will be activated at this time. Another throttle depression will turn them off.
  2. Connect DVOM to self-test output pin 4. Start the KEY ON-ENGINE OFF (KOEO) SELF-TEST  . When Continuous codes are completed, DVOM will read 0 volts. Depress accelerator to turn on actuators.
  3. Disconnect DVOM from pin 4 and connect to appropriate actuator. Measure voltage at actuator. Readings above 10.5 volts indicate actuators are on, readings below 2 volts indicate actuators are off. Each test will tell what action to take according to voltage shown on DVOM.
